Running a 269-Unit Community in Denver's University Hills Corridor

Colorado Station Apartments sits at 3725 E Buchtel Blvd, a 269-unit mid-rise community in a high-demand Denver submarket. RedPeak, a Denver-native owner-operator with 24 years focused exclusively on the Front Range, is hiring a Community Manager to run this asset. This is a full P&L role: you own occupancy, NOI, delinquency, team performance, and the resident experience from lease-up to renewal.

RedPeak operates as an in-house platform, meaning you're not reporting to a third-party management company. Decisions move faster, accountability is direct, and the support structure is built around people who actually know Denver neighborhoods. The company's stated culture puts residents in the neighbor category, which shows up operationally in how service calls and lease renewals get handled.

What the Day-to-Day Looks Like

Monday through Friday, 9 to 6. You're the senior operator on site. That means owning the budget, reviewing actuals against the T-12, and understanding where variances are coming from. Delinquency management, lease expirations, concession strategy, traffic-to-lease conversion rates , these are your numbers to track and move. You're also coordinating maintenance, which at a single-building 269-unit property means staying close to your make-ready pipeline and punch lists without getting buried in them.

On the team side, you're guiding and motivating the onsite staff. Leasing, service, communications , you set the standard. The role comes with bonus potential tied to results, and there's a monthly maintenance bonus component built into the comp structure.

  • Market-rate property management experience, with demonstrated financial and operational results
  • Comfort running budgets, reporting financials, and interpreting performance data
  • Strong resident-facing instincts , you know how to de-escalate, retain, and build community
  • Tech fluency across leasing platforms, communications tools, and maintenance coordination software
  • Leadership presence: your team takes cues from you on pace, professionalism, and follow-through
Compensation, Benefits, And Career Context

The base range is $65,000 to $85,000 annually, plus bonus. Benefits include full medical, dental, and vision coverage, employer-paid short-term disability, a 401(k) with company match that vests on day one, 16 PTO days, 10 paid holidays, and a 20% rent discount. RedPeak also offers a student debt repayment program, a scholarship fund administered by the Denver Foundation, and up to $75 monthly toward a health club membership.

RedPeak describes this as well-suited for an entry-to-mid-level Community Manager looking to grow. That's meaningful context: if you're coming off a successful run as an Assistant Manager and ready to own a full asset, this is a legitimate path in. A single building at 269 units is a manageable scope for a first full Community Manager role, and RedPeak's in-house model means you'll have direct visibility into how ownership-level decisions get made, which accelerates development faster than most fee-management shops.

Strong candidates will bring a track record of occupancy performance they can speak to with actual numbers, not just general experience descriptions. Knowing your T-12, being able to explain a delinquency trend, and having a point of view on concessions strategy will separate you in the interview process.
